The question

Are there daily litanies (awrad) or specific formulas for praying upon the Prophet (peace be upon him), and are there daily remembrances (adhkar) as well?

The answer

Praying for the Prophet (peace be upon him) is among the remembrances with immense reward. For whoever prays for him once, Allah will pray for him ten times. A hadith, graded as hasan by Al-Albani, states that whoever prays for the Prophet (peace be upon him) ten times in the morning and ten times in the evening will receive his intercession on the Day of Judgment. This specific wording is not fixed, and it is better to limit oneself to what has been authentically transmitted. A Muslim should frequently pray for the Prophet (peace be upon him) and engage in all types of remembrance.
